The Company
About Strata Clean Energy
-Founded in 2008 as a rooftop solar installer, it evolved into a utility‑scale clean energy powerhouse. -Privately held and family‑owned, it focuses on long‑term performance with ownership of projects. -Built standout projects like the Saticoy battery and Scatter Wash storage complex. -Acquired Crossover Energy Partners to enhance customer origination, offtake structuring, and green hydrogen capabilities. -Operates end‑to‑end across development, financing, EPC, and O&M, delivering turnkey utility‑scale renewable energy.
